If Halsin dies in Act 2 of Baldur's Gate 3, several narrative paths and character interactions are affected. You will lose certain questlines and possible outcomes tied to his character, which might change the course of your story. It also means you cannot unlock dialogues and missions specific to Halsin's arc, impacting your overall game experience.
